Yep I listened to it, thought it was a decent enough version for a live concert, certainly would get the crowd going.

However, I didn´t like the way he changed the phrasing from that which constantly bounces up and down when Paul sings and progresses as the song moves forward, Ryan changed the intonation of every line to be exactly the same which kind of stole away the meaning of the song and lyrics and made it monotonous. In the same way Paul made Homeward Bound that way deliberately. It was as if he couldn´t manage the song, which I can imagine being entirely possible. It´s a very hard song to sing except for Paul (and his fans!)

I liked the penny whistle solo being played on the sax though, that was quite cool.

All in all a little bit light weight and pop-i-fied but nevertheless a decent enough attempt and not crineworthy to listen to like some covers are.

Uh, so now I was watching that video.

Well, I have to say that I wouldn´t like that song if this would be the original - I guess I wouldn´t even know it then.
But knowing the song as ´Paul Simons You Can Call Me Al´ - and beeing a fan of Paul Simon, I would always be happy if I hear anyone playing it - especially at a live concert.

For me this version sounds like a few other songs which have been hit´s in the 90´s... can´t say any names now.. like some Cranberries songs, or hm... I don´t know, it sounds as if I hear that song on the radio every few weeks. I guess I have a song like that at home as an mp3... Maybe from Marc Anthony ...?


I agree with Matthew - Paul simons phrasing is much better. Rayn is just singin the words without any emphasis on different words. This song is famous for it´s spoken words like:
"Who?ll be my rooole model
Now that my rooole model is
Goooone goooone
He ducked back down the alley
With some roly-poly little bat-faced girl

All alooong aloooong
There were incidents and accidents...

Thats all lost, and thats the most important thing in that song.


All in all I have to say I don´t like it. It sounds as boring as a lot of those accoustic guitar songs played fast and live. The famous bass (not the solo, the overall bass sound) is lost. The special rhythm YCCMA has doesn´t appear in that version. The original is much more relaxed. The pause when Ryan sings 1 or 2 lines without instruments is typical and can be heard in 1 Million other pop songs. While the overal song seems to be much faster the sax line is at the same speed, and that doesn´t fit together.

And again, I knew that song with other lyrics...especially the part when he sings ´You can call meeeeaa eea Aaaaeiilll´.. that melody is from another song.
